Job Description

We are seeking a Junior Security Analyst to join our team in Fort Wayne, IN . This role is ideal for a detail-oriented and security-focused professional with 3-5 years of experience in IT security, patch management, or a related field. As part of our team, you will assist in monitoring security operations, managing patching processes, and providing desktop support when needed.

Key Responsibilities

Security Monitoring & Incident Response

  • Continuously monitor security logs across systems and applications to detect potential threats.
  • Identify actionable security issues, escalate critical concerns, and assist in resolving lower-risk incidents.
  • Respond to security incidents, document findings, and contribute to investigations.

Patch Management & Vulnerability Remediation

  • Assist in the identification, testing, and deployment of patches for operating systems and applications.
  • Coordinate and track patch cycles to ensure timely updates and vulnerability mitigation.
  • Monitor for missing patches, prioritize issues based on severity, and work with IT teams to resolve security gaps.

Endpoint Security Management

  • Support the maintenance of endpoint security solutions, including antivirus software, firewalls, and endpoint detection tools.
  • Ensure endpoint security agents are up to date and troubleshoot related issues.

Desktop Support

  • Provide technical support for software, hardware, and system access issues.
  • Assist with setting up new devices and ensuring compliance with security policies.
  • Troubleshoot network connectivity and system errors to maintain operational efficiency.

System Auditing & Compliance

  • Conduct regular audits to ensure compliance with security policies and industry best practices.
  • Review and verify log retention settings and manage allow lists and blocklists for access control.

Vulnerability Scanning & Reporting

  • Perform scheduled vulnerability scans on networked systems and applications.
  • Analyze scan results, categorize vulnerabilities, and assist in developing remediation strategies.
  • Generate reports to track remediation progress and improve security visibility.

Software & Hardware Maintenance

  • Assist in managing software and hardware inventories, identifying outdated or unsupported systems.
  • Work with IT teams to update or replace software to maintain security compliance.

Collaboration & Continuous Improvement

  • Work closely with senior analysts and IT teams to enhance security policies and procedures.
  • Stay informed on emerging threats and security trends, recommending proactive measures.

Qualifications & Experience

  • 3-5 years of experience in IT security, patch management, or related fields.
  • Familiarity with endpoint security, vulnerability assessment, and patching tools .
  • Basic understanding of network security and firewall configurations .
  • Strong analytical skills, attention to detail, and problem-solving abilities .
  • Excellent communication and teamwork skills.

Preferred Skills

  • Certifications such as Security+, CySA+, or equivalent (preferred but not required).
  • Experience working in an IT or security operations environment .
  • Exposure to industrial control systems security is a plus.
